Output 3acd9582d77aa09d975c79bd55067208021d6798cf8ec0edef9f782310cd86a4: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4653b86ed40616e88a9d801792146f69e6dc8e61 OP_EQUAL
address
386sWyDhkRg81QDyX6d34wEKqK95QEaKdL
transaction
3acd9582d77aa09d975c79bd55067208021d6798cf8ec0edef9f782310cd86a4
confirmations
418914
spent
true